Canadian Seed Standards play a crucial role in maintaining the quality and integrity of pedigreed seed. The key purpose of these standards is to ensure that seeds meet specific quality criteria, which include being free from prohibited noxious weeds. This is essential for protecting crop production, maintaining agricultural health, and preventing the spread of invasive species that could harm crops or the environment. By regulating the presence of harmful weeds in seeds, these standards contribute to successful crop establishment and growth while supporting the overall sustainability of agricultural practices in Canada.
